数据库管理系统是指什么
-
数据库管理系统(Database Management System,简称DBMS)是一种用于管理和组织数据的软件系统。它是建立在数据库之上的软件,用于存储、检索、修改和管理大量结构化和非结构化数据。数据库管理系统允许用户对数据库中的数据进行操作,包括查询、插入、更新和删除。
以下是数据库管理系统的一些重要特点和功能:
-
数据管理:数据库管理系统可以有效地管理大量数据,包括存储、组织、索引和备份数据。它提供了数据的集中存储和访问,使得数据可以被多个用户同时使用。
-
数据安全性:数据库管理系统提供了一系列安全机制来保护数据的机密性、完整性和可用性。它可以通过用户身份验证、访问控制和数据加密等方式来防止未经授权的访问和数据泄露。
-
数据一致性:数据库管理系统可以保证数据的一致性,即在数据库中的数据应该始终保持正确和可靠。它提供了事务管理和并发控制机制,确保多个用户并发操作数据库时数据的一致性。
-
数据查询和分析:数据库管理系统支持强大的查询语言和分析工具,可以快速检索和分析大量数据。用户可以使用结构化查询语言(SQL)来编写复杂的查询语句,以满足各种数据分析和业务需求。
-
数据备份和恢复:数据库管理系统提供了数据备份和恢复的功能,以防止数据丢失或损坏。它可以定期备份数据库,并在发生故障或意外情况下恢复数据,确保数据的可靠性和可恢复性。
总之,数据库管理系统是一种重要的软件工具,用于管理和操作大量数据。它提供了数据的存储、检索、修改和管理功能,同时保证数据的安全性、一致性和可靠性。数据库管理系统在各个领域和行业都有广泛的应用,包括企业管理、科学研究、医疗保健、金融服务等。
1年前 -
-
数据库管理系统(Database Management System,简称DBMS)是一种用来管理和组织数据的软件系统。它允许用户创建、访问和管理数据库,以及对数据库中的数据进行操作和维护。
数据库管理系统提供了一种结构化的方式来存储和组织数据,以便用户可以方便地对数据进行存储、检索和更新。它提供了一组功能和工具,使用户能够定义数据库的结构(即数据模型)、存储数据、查询数据、更新数据以及控制数据的访问。
数据库管理系统的主要功能包括:
-
数据定义:数据库管理系统允许用户定义数据库的结构,包括数据表、字段、索引等。用户可以定义不同类型的数据和数据之间的关系,以及对数据的约束条件。
-
数据存储:数据库管理系统负责将数据存储在物理介质上,例如硬盘或闪存。它管理数据的存储方式,包括数据的分配、存储和组织方式,以及数据的备份和恢复。
-
数据查询:数据库管理系统提供了一种高效的方式来查询数据库中的数据。用户可以使用结构化查询语言(SQL)来编写查询语句,从数据库中检索所需的数据。
-
数据更新:数据库管理系统允许用户对数据库中的数据进行更新、插入和删除操作。用户可以使用SQL语句来执行这些操作,以保持数据库中的数据的一致性和完整性。
-
数据安全性:数据库管理系统提供了一些安全机制来保护数据库中的数据。它可以通过用户身份验证、访问控制和数据加密等方式来防止非授权的访问和数据泄露。
-
数据一致性:数据库管理系统通过实施事务管理和并发控制来确保数据库中的数据一致性。它允许多个用户同时对数据库进行操作,同时保证数据的正确性和完整性。
总之,数据库管理系统是一种重要的软件工具,它提供了一种有效的方式来管理和组织数据。它允许用户创建、访问和管理数据库,并提供了一系列功能来保护数据的安全性和一致性。在现代信息时代,数据库管理系统已成为各种应用领域中不可或缺的基础设施。
1年前 -
-
数据库管理系统(Database Management System,简称DBMS)是一种用来管理和操作数据库的软件系统。它允许用户创建、修改、存储和检索数据,并提供了高效的数据访问和管理方法。数据库管理系统是计算机科学领域中非常重要的一部分,广泛应用于各种类型的应用程序,包括企业资源管理、客户关系管理、电子商务、物流管理等。
数据库管理系统主要由三个组件组成:数据库引擎、数据定义语言(DDL)和数据操作语言(DML)。数据库引擎是DBMS的核心组件,负责管理数据的存储和检索。数据定义语言用于定义和管理数据库的结构,包括创建表、定义索引、设置约束等操作。数据操作语言用于对数据库进行增删改查操作,包括插入数据、更新数据、删除数据和查询数据。
数据库管理系统具有以下几个主要功能:
-
数据存储和管理:数据库管理系统提供了有效的数据存储和管理机制,可以将数据以表格的形式存储在数据库中,并提供了对数据的高效访问方法。
-
数据安全性和完整性:数据库管理系统具有强大的安全性和完整性控制机制,可以对数据进行权限管理、数据加密和数据备份等操作,确保数据的安全性和完整性。
-
数据共享和并发控制:数据库管理系统支持多用户同时访问数据库,并提供了并发控制机制,可以保证数据的一致性和并发性。
-
数据备份和恢复:数据库管理系统提供了数据备份和恢复的功能,可以定期备份数据库,以防止数据丢失或损坏,并在需要时恢复数据。
-
数据查询和分析:数据库管理系统提供了强大的查询和分析功能,可以根据用户的需求进行复杂的数据查询和分析操作,支持多种查询语言和查询优化技术。
在实际应用中,数据库管理系统还可以根据具体需求扩展功能,例如支持分布式数据库、支持多种数据类型和数据格式、支持数据挖掘和机器学习等。总之,数据库管理系统是一种重要的软件工具,可以帮助用户高效地管理和操作数据,提高数据的安全性和可用性。
1年前 -